Glider Dream Meaning

What does seeing a glider in a dream mean? Gliders are often associated with the idea of flying freely without the need for an engine. Dreaming about a glider may symbolize a desire for freedom, independence, and a sense of liberation in your waking life. It could indicate a need to break free from constraints or limitations that are holding you back.

Gliding involves taking risks and experiencing the thrill of flying. Dreaming about a glider may represent your willingness to embark on new adventures and explore uncharted territories. It could signify your desire to embrace challenges and step out of your comfort zone.

Gliders gracefully soar through the air, seemingly unaffected by the ground below. Dreaming about a glider may symbolize your ability to rise above life's challenges and difficulties with ease. It could suggest that you have the capacity to handle obstacles with grace and composure.

Gliding through the air can evoke feelings of calmness and tranquility. Dreaming about a glider may signify a desire for peace of mind and a need to find inner harmony in your waking life.

Gliding silently through the sky can have spiritual connotations. Dreaming about a glider might represent your spiritual journey and a longing for a deeper connection with your higher self or the divine.

Gliders experience a sense of weightlessness while flying. Dreaming about a sailplane may symbolize a desire to let go of burdens and responsibilities, seeking relief from the weight of everyday life.

In some cases, dreaming about a glider could reflect your ambitions and aspirations. It may suggest that you are setting your sights high and striving to reach your goals with determination.

According to the American dreambook, a glider in a dream can symbolize flying on the winds of change.
